Rapid On-site Detection of Microleakage of Lithium Battery Electrolytes by Vacuum-Assisted Volatilization-Portable Gas Chromatography-Mass Spectrometry
With the surge in demand for lithium-ion batteries in various fields, concerns about their safety have increased. Electrolyte leakage, as a critical safety hazard, often goes unnoticed due to its subtle occurrence and the volatility of electrolyte components. In the application of on-site analysis,...
